Did you know October is National Orthodontic Health Month? Now it also happens to be the month when candy seems to be around every corner! Orthodontic health compromises everything from the strength of your teeth, to ensuring only the highest grade of materials is used to get your teeth straight. Though often seen as relating to aesthetic results, braces help with many oral conditions that could lead to problems related to the jaw, chewing and general oral hygiene. If you are currently in treatment, dedicate this month to bringing more awareness of how to keep your teeth and gums strong and healthy. Perhaps refresh yourself of the do’s and don't's during treatment. Avoid the sticky or hard candy, and perhaps decrease your intake of any teeth-staining foods. Regardless of whether you are in or out of braces, remember that sugar erodes calcium from the tooth’s enamel, leading to an increased risk of cavities. If you do indulge in a treat or two, brush your teeth as soon as possible afterwards. Mostly have a happy, safe and healthy Halloween!
